NO HEAT
KitchenAid · KWED5000HW 7.0 cu. ft. Electric Dryer with Wrinkle Shield Option
Dryer drum rotates normally but produces no heat. Most common cause: tripped circuit breaker — electric dryers need both legs of 240V. If one pole trips, motor runs (120V) but element won't energize (needs 240V). Also check: heating element continuity, high-limit thermostat, thermal fuse. Always check exhaust vent when thermal components fail.
